On one of my recent visits, I decided to purchase and download an ebook that Jill Winger from The Prairie Homestead wrote called Your Custom Homestead, Awakening a Fresh Vision of Homesteading. It was $4.99 and I believe, well worth it. In it, she walks you through 21 days of practical things you can do to begin homesteading right where you are. She even dedicates some of the chapters to helping you establish a vision for your homestead by writing down goals, a mission statement and even has you recognize the reasons behind why you want to homestead. It is an easy read and the chapters are short (there are only 78 pages in the entire book).

One of the first thing Jill recommends you do is to put together a binder to keep all of your thoughts and ideas and resources in one place.
